The following is a brief overview of my new (as at August 2005) farm - John Drummond

Hi there! Welcome to my 'farm' and dark sky observing site. This small farm is 12kms to the west of Gisborne near the little township of Patutahi. The site offers a dark site (apart from the slight glow of 30,000 population Gisborne 12km to the east). The weather in Gisborne is often fine due to it's leeward location on the east coast - where the prevalent wind in NZ is a westerly. I have two 16" scopes - and other smaller scopes...
